<refentry id="function.fbsql-insert-id">
<refnamediv>
<refname>fbsql_insert_id</refname>
<refpurpose>
Get the id generated from the previous INSERT operation
</refpurpose>
</refnamediv>
<refsect1>
&reftitle.description;
<methodsynopsis>
<type>int</type><methodname>fbsql_insert_id</methodname>
<methodparam choice="opt"><type>resource</type><parameter>
link_identifier
</parameter></methodparam>
</methodsynopsis>
<para>
<function>fbsql_insert_id</function> returns the ID generated for
an column defined as DEFAULT UNIQUE by the previous INSERT query
using the given <parameter>link_identifier</parameter>. If
<parameter>link_identifier</parameter> isn't specified, the last
opened link is assumed.
</para>
<para>
<function>fbsql_insert_id</function> returns 0 if the previous
query does not generate an DEFAULT UNIQUE value. If you need to
save the value for later, be sure to call fbsql_insert_id()
immediately after the query that generates the value.
</para>
<note>
<para>
The value of the FrontBase SQL function
<function>fbsql_insert_id</function> always contains the most
recently generated DEFAULT UNIQUE value, and is not reset
between queries.
</para>
</note>
</refsect1>
</refentry>
